AI Technical Summary
Existing filter bags do not perform well under complex operating conditions and are difficult to maintain stable filtration performance.
The filter material adopts a multi-layer filter material structure, including an aramid fiber filter bag body, an antistatic polyester needle-punched felt inner layer, a PPS fiber inner layer, a reinforced polyester needle-punched felt outer reinforcing layer, and a PTFE membrane filter material layer. The combination design of fixing buckles, fixing rings, and limiting buckles ensures that the filter material is stably positioned inside the filter bag.
It improves the filtration performance and stability of filter bags under complex working conditions, enhances antistatic, high temperature resistance, corrosion resistance and impact resistance, achieves efficient filtration of fine particles, and meets strict environmental emission standards.

TECHNICAL FIELD
[0001] The utility model relates to filter bag technical field especially, it relates to a kind of environmental protection filter bag with built-in filter material. BACKGROUND
[0002] Filter bag is a kind of bag-like device for filtering, usually made of specific fiber material, widely used in industrial dust removal, air purification, liquid filtration and other fields, it is intercepted by physical or chemical action, solid particles, impurities etc in gas or liquid, to achieve the purpose of purifying gas or liquid.
[0003] The filter bag currently used is limited to basic dust filtration in function, and the filtering effect is not ideal for tiny dust particles with particle size below micron, in addition, when used under complex working conditions, the filter bag is difficult to maintain stable filtering performance, thereby further affecting the overall filtering effect. [0021] Working principle: the filter bag body 1 adopts aramid fiber, its high strength, excellent high temperature resistance and wear resistance, ensure that the filter bag body 1 maintains stable structure under complex working conditions, prolong the service life; The top hook 2 provides convenience for installing and dismounting the filter bag body 1, reduces the operation difficulty, improves the work efficiency; In the filter material body 3, the first built-in layer 8 made of anti-static polyester needle felt can effectively prevent static accumulation and avoid safety hazards caused by static electricity, and its smooth surface is beneficial to dust removal and reduces the running resistance; The second built-in layer 9 made of PPS fiber material has excellent high temperature resistance and chemical corrosion resistance, which can ensure the stable work of the filter material body 3 in high temperature, strong acid and alkali and other harsh environments, and continuously play the filtering role; The external reinforcing layer 7 of the reinforced polyester needle felt further enhances the strength of the filter material body 3, resists external impact and friction, and reduces the risk of damage; The internal coating layer 10 made of PTFE coating filter material has a submicron level of extremely small pore size, which can realize high-precision interception of small particle pollutants and meet the strict environmental emission standards; The combination design of the fixing buckle 4, the fixing ring 5 and the limiting buckle 6 stabilizes the position of the filter material body 3 in the filter bag body 1, prevents the filter material body 3 from shifting and shaking during the filtering process, and ensures the synergistic and efficient operation of each layer of material.
